About CTR and Herd Adventures:
Established in 2003, Chesapeake Therapeutic Riding (CTR)'s mission is to deliver healing and learning to individuals and groups whose minds, bodies and spirits will benefit from the transformative connection between people and horses.

Since our first rider held reins in 2005, CTR has served thousands of residents of Harford County, MD, and the surrounding areas. Regardless of our clients' ages, CTR uses horses and horse-related activities as a means to provide adaptive recreation and educational activities to children and adults who live with disabilities, at-risk youth, and veterans.

Our certified staff and trained volunteers are dedicated to serving people through therapeutic riding lessons (adaptive recreation), EAL (Equine Assisted Learning), and Horse Powered Learning (educational activities that are unmounted). We are a Premier Accredited Center of PATH International, the Professional Association of Therapeutic Horsemanship.

Our herd of Gentle Horses is the heart of the work at CTR. They come from varied backgrounds and experiences and are all uniquely gifted for the work they help us do, as we help people. These are some of our horses' stories, and we hope you enjoy reading them as much as we enjoyed writing them. Any proceeds from the sale of these books will go back into CTR programming and herd care--so we can continue to deliver healing and learning to individuals and groups whose minds, bodies and spirits will benefit from the transformative connection between people and horses.

About the Author

Author Harriett Hooff (also known as CTR Program Director, Katy Santiff) grew up in Maryland with tons of family pets and several horses. She loves to write and is a published poet. She knows intrinsically how much the connection with creatures we love can mean to us, and how much we can learn from them. She chose this pen name to honor one of these creatures, a mule named Harriett, and her father—Bill Santiff.

About the Illustrator:
Mark Weaver is a graduate of The Pennsylvania State University with degrees in both Art Education and Sculpture. Originally a Central Pennsylvania native, they now live outside of Baltimore as a full time artist and ceramic studio instructor. Although Mark frequently makes three-dimensional artwork, they love working with any and every medium they can get their hands on (from clay, to paint, to digital media).
